No one injured at The Boss’ “Be Out Day.”

Ricky Ross 

One man was arrested and another was being sought by police after gunshots disrupted a Florida charity event hosted by rapper Rick Ross. The Boss held his annual “Be Out Day” celebration this week, an event where he distributes food and school supplies, and encourages voter registration. Flo-Rida had performed and Ross had just taken the stage when the suspects began shooting and sending participants diving for cover. “The shots happened near the event … across the street, but it was close enough that it seemed as if it happened in the park (where the show was taking place),” says Elora Mason, publicist for Rick Ross Charities, Inc. “It’s not clear what brought it on, but police said the person shooting appeared to be shooting in the air.” The investigation is ongoing. Police cleared the stage, but Ross later returned to do a short performance and then sign autographs for some of those who remained. Ross says 2,000 backpacks were distributed.

Morgan Freeman reportedly “resting comfortably.”

Morgan Freeman 

Having undergone surgery for injuries connected to a weekend car crash, actor Morgan Freeman is back at home. A spokesman for the veteran actor says he left Memphis’ Regional Medical Center on Thursday. “He was released today at noon local time and is now resting comfortably,” Ken Sunshine says. Freeman and his passenger Demaris Meyer, who reportedly gave the hospital a phony name to hide her relationship with the married-but-separated star, were traveling in Mississippi when he lost control of the vehicle. Both occupants had to be cut out of the Nissan. Freeman later revealed that he and his long-time wife Myrna have been separated since December, apparently to quell speculation about Meyer’s identity. She was also treated for her injuries.

Remy Ma hopes legal eagle can come to rescue.

 Remy Ma

Just three months into an eight-year sentence for felonious assault, weapons possession and attempted coercion, rapper Remy Ma has hired a lawyer who she hopes will help her appeal her way to freedom. William “Billy” Murphy Jr. won an acquittal on behalf of boxing promoter Don King in 1998 after he’d been charged with defrauding Lloyd’s of London. Murphy has also represented DMX and Mary J. Blige, among other celebrities. “With the addition of Mr. Murphy…I now believe I have assembled a team that will have the might and expertise to tell my side of the story,” Remy says in a statement. “I am confident that after hearing everything, my side will prevail.” Remy was convicted this spring in the shooting of her former friend Makeda Barnes-Joseph in a dispute over money.

Morgan Freeman’s companion during accident was reportedly wife’s former friend
If you wondered who the initially unidentified woman injured along with Morgan Freeman in his recent car wreck was, you weren’t alone. Having denied several weeks ago that he knew anything about his wife Myrna seeking a divorce, reportedly due to his alleged cheating, word has surfaced that Freeman and his long-time spouse became separated months ago. Freeman suffered broken bones this past weekend when he and Demaris Meyer were involved in a single-car accident after Freeman lost control of his car on a Mississippi road. He’s recovering at a Memphis hospital after arm surgery, and Meyer is reportedly in good condition. The National Enquirer magazine reports that Meyer had been friends with Freeman’s wife before becoming involved with the Oscar-winner. He’s expected to be released from the hospital this week.

Beyoncé’s face appears lighter in ad. The TMZ.com celeb gossip Web site has started a buzz about singer Beyoncé by printing her photo in a new L’Oreal makeup ad. Fans and visitors to the site gave mixed reactions to TMZ’s comparison of a tannish Mrs. Shawn Carter next to L’Oreal’s much paler-skinned pic of the singer, which TMZ argued was “severely Photoshopped.” The alleged skin-lightening job in the advertisement renders Be “almost unrecognizable,” TMZ says. Some comments posted to the site, which polled whether the ad offends Blacks, express disappointment that the singer could approve it. Others suggest that Beyoncé’s naturally fair complexion may have been lighter due to seasonal change at the time of the L’Oreal photo. So far, no word from the singer’s camp about the criticism.

Jay-Z’s club could be hit with a class-action lawsuit
A Manhattan judge has ordered management at rapper Jay-Z’s nightclub to turn over the names of all employees from the past three years. An ex-waitress’ lawyer wanted the names, in connection with a lawsuit that alleges Jigga’s establishment didn’t pay minimum wage or overtime. “This is a good day for restaurant workers all over the city,” said plaintiff’s attorney Maimon Kirschenbaum. He’s reportedly planning to recruit from hundreds of other club workers who may want to join the lawsuit.

Morgan Freeman, wife have 24 years together
Morgan Freeman says he has no knowledge of where rumors that he’s anticipating a divorce from his wife of 24 years originated. The actor was reportedly questioned about his marital status at a recent celebrity event, following word that he’d been unfaithful. “I don’t know anything about that,” Freeman said. A spokesman for the actor, who’s currently co-starring role is in the Matrix-esque film Wanted, adds: “We officially have no comment.”
